We were unable to install the necessary dependencies to be able to run Genivi Software Manager on NGI 1.0. I rewrote the program to work with RPyC instead of dbus for interprocess communication.

I also changed the print calls to output directly to log files. The main rationale behind this is because we can't view the output of the Software Manager components as there is no way to launch a terminal window on the IMC.

Tested on NGI 1.12.5.4.2, we used the RPyC version to successfully install an .rpm on the rig.
